    My dex Bear (zaghorakis) stats are below. Whenever I hit level 55 I changed from pure str to str/dex, allowing me to retain the best armour, but also enabling me to equip the metallic stiletto of destiny which is a dex weapon with lowish 58-61 damage but high speed 0.4 and dps. I've read the guides on damage and dps, discussing the advance of dps but also bearing in mind that low damage weapons fairs poorly against mob high armours. I was wondering if there is any resource/equations/excel documents etc where I can quantify the differences to make the best, informed equipment decision. Anecdotally, I can see that my stiletto fairs far better than the str weapons against the vast majority of mobs, but I suspect it may be the reverse in pvp and against bosses.

    It's a bit frustrating as I can't definitively quantify the difference and find myself continually questioning my build. Help!

    That stilleto gets too much praise for what it is worth. You are doing 101-104 damage which is then subtracted by ~75, which leaves you doing 25 damage per hit. While using a weapon such as a strength level 55 sword you will be doing about 200 damage per hit -75 = 125 damage. Do a critical hit and do 250+ damage. IMO daggers should never be used.

    I usually will use my tanking gear for mobs, and if there is another tank I will switch to my dex set once we get to the boss.

    Agreed, much like the Blizzard Worthless Stick of Fate does...high DPS due to the speed but crummy base damage. Sewers enemies actually have roughly 120 armor give or take a few...seeing as you can't do negative damage unbuffed, using a Blizz Stick or a Stiletto it does give you some minor damage.

    A lot of dual spec Str/Int bears (myself and Silent apparently, and many others) use a tank set for the mobs, and switch to dex/Bowbear for the bosses via quick loadouts...or some run Bowbear constantly, although a little more challenging to tank with the lower Bowbear armor. Just another idea.

    i always believe Base Damage are the real damage in this game , not like in WOW , in WOW that DPS means Damage per sec in the combat , at most time highest DSP also lead to high damage done , but in PL , Dps is more like a useless # , it only tells you how you can do damage per sec on a 0 armor target , unfortunately in PL all the mobs has armor , high lvl mobs and boss even got higher armor , so the DPS in here is mean absolute nothing ....

    for example my Mystery set got more DPS then my Customized Recurve set , but my highest crit hit in mystery set (lv53~55) only about 700+ , only few days in Customized Recurve set i already saw few times crit hit 1500+ on boss ....

    with a 100+ base damage weapon in sewer your DPH (damage per hit) on boss mainly shows single digit ,am i right ?
